One way to target your customers with specific ads is to add your email list to the “custom audience” feature on Facebook. This is a good way to improve your conversion ratio and reduce what you spend to develop your campaign.

If you have a company like a car business, you might not want a specific Facebook page but instead use targeted Facebook ads. Customers tend not to follow such pages unless they actually need the item. Use ads instead of a Facebook page in this circumstance.

Do not disable the function permitting folks to leave comments at your site. You may believe that this is a way to prevent people from posting bad content, but what will happen is that people will think that you don’t value their opinion.

Have the design of the Facebook page be like the one on your website. Keep the same color scheme on your page. It will help people relate your page to your brand. If they are vastly different from one another, your following will get confused.

Don’t use Facebook Update too often. Updating lets you deliver messages to all of your subscribers. Only use it for very important events and news like an emergency, etc. However, using it all the time will get old to your followers.
